I have to agree with the others, I see no reason to change what is already a good 200 yard chambering.

I reload for my Marlin 336 30-30 using 150gr Win round nose bullets and 35gr of IMR3031. That load gives me a 1.75" 10 shot group at 100 yards any time Ishoot it. It clocks right at 2500fps and I dropped a nice bodyed young buck this year with it at 160 yards. My gun only has a 20" barrel, with a longer barrel it should be a little faster. I'm looking forward to Hornady's releasing the new pointed bullet mentioned earlier which looks like it could extend the effective range of this old cartridge by up to 100 yards or more.

If you reload for your gun you would not be limited to the standard 30-30 fare. If this is the case you could use whatever pointed/boat tail design bullet you want to achieve the desired results using the chamber you already have. If you don't reload, I would put theupgrade money into reloading gear instead.
